My battery wouldn't charge after it completely discharged today. The battery status showed up as "ERROR".
Does that mean my battery is totally dead? It lasted about 85 mins before it shutdown. It's been used for 180 cycles something.

If you're handy with a multi-meter you can check the voltage and amps across the probes to see if you get any result, the hardware maintenance manual has the voltages for the pins and also the ohms across the pins. I read a while back that there is a thermistor in the battery for protection that can short out.
